What is adp?

ADP (Automatic Data Processing) is a comprehensive payroll and human resources management software. Its primary purpose is to streamline payroll processing and HR functions for businesses of various sizes.

What is namely?

Namely is a human resources platform designed for small to mid-sized businesses. Its primary purpose is to provide an integrated solution for HR management, payroll, and employee engagement.

Frequently Asked Questions

What types of businesses typically use ADP?

ADP is commonly used by large enterprises that need comprehensive payroll and HR solutions.

Can Namely handle payroll processing?

Yes, Namely includes payroll processing as part of its HR management platform.

Is customer support available for both platforms?

Yes, both ADP and Namely offer customer support, but the availability and methods may vary.

Are there mobile apps for ADP and Namely?

Yes, both platforms provide mobile applications for employee self-service and HR management tasks.
